Arista Networks has set its sights on expanding its footprint in campus networking environments, with a clear goal to grow its business to $1.25 billion by 2026. The company’s CEO, Jayshree Ullal, emphasized this commitment, highlighting successful deployments in routing edge, core spine, and peering use cases. The recent launch of the flagship 7800 R4 spine, boasting 460 terabits of capacity, showcases Arista’s dedication to meeting the demanding needs of multiservice routing, AI workloads, and switching use cases.
Ethernet technologies play a crucial role in Arista’s product lineup, with a focus on core cloud, AI, and data center products that leverage the highly differentiated Arista EOS stack. Ullal emphasized the deployment of Ethernet speeds ranging from 10 gig to 800 gigabit, with a migration to 1.6 terabits on the horizon. The company’s EtherLink AI portfolio and 7000 series platforms offer best-in-class performance, power efficiency, and automation for both front and back-end computing, storage, and interconnect zones. Arista anticipates a further boost in Ethernet adoption with the upcoming release of the multivendor Ethernet for Scale-Up Networking (ESUN) specification.
Driven by its growing hyperscale customer base, Arista projects a significant increase in AI networking revenue, aiming to double its revenue to $3.25 billion by 2026.
